Once equilibrium is reached, __________.a. molecules move, but there is no net movement in a particular direction. b. passive tr

ansport starts over to create a concentration gradient. c. the membrane permits all molecules to freely move across the membrane. d. molecules no longer move.
Biology
1 answer:
SCORPION-xisa [38]3 years ago
7 0

Answer: molecules move, but there is no net movement in a particular direction.

Option A is correct.

Explanation:

When equilibrium is reached, particles of a solution will continue to move across the membrane in both directions. However, because almost equal numbers of particles move in each direction, there is no further change in concentration. Equilibrium is reached in a system when the concentration of a solute is equal on both sides of the membrane.

A person is told to take 1.25 mg of vitamin d daily. how many 0.125-mg tablets should this person take?
vovikov84 [41]
This is a simple calculation involving drug doses.

The solution is as follows:

(0.125 mg/tablet)(n) = 1.25 mg
n = (1.25 mg)/(0.125 mg/tablet)
n = 10 tablets

So a person needs to take ten 0.125 mg tablets of vitamin D to have that 1.25 mg dose.
